Who were the Gnostics? And how did the Gnostic movement influence the development of Christianity in antiquity? Is it true that the Church rejected Gnosticism? This book offers an illuminating discussion of scholarly debates over the concept of 'Gnosticism' and the nature of early Christian diversity.
